Output 58b25adf000104004b800c2df48b046644f52e22264bd85fa12df5b2bf8658d4:389

value
1721624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71590ed1682db0e2c44099c0eac15139800beea5 OP_EQUAL
address
DFURanWX8wYwAZcfUiYS4BNDdnZdfd3dyM
transaction
58b25adf000104004b800c2df48b046644f52e22264bd85fa12df5b2bf8658d4
spent
true